Real-World Testing: Putting Coleman Heritage 10in. Big Tall Sleeping Bag to the Test
First Use Experience
I tested the Coleman Heritage 10in. Big Tall Sleeping Bag during a late-fall camping trip in the Allegheny National Forest. Nighttime temperatures dipped into the low 20s. I wanted a rigorous first trial of its advertised 10-degree rating.
The bag performed admirably in the cold. I remained comfortably warm throughout the night, even with only a base layer of clothing. The Comfort Cuff feature was a welcome addition, keeping my face cozy and protected from the chill.
Getting in and out of the bag was easy thanks to the snag-free zipper. The Thermolock system effectively minimized heat loss. I didn’t experience any cold spots, a common issue with other sleeping bags I’ve used.
My only minor issue was the bag’s size within my one-person tent. The extra space inside the bag was great for comfort, but it took up a significant amount of room inside the tent. I had to be strategic with my gear placement.

Breaking Down the Features of Coleman Heritage 10in. Big Tall Sleeping Bag
Specifications
The Coleman Heritage 10in. Big Tall Sleeping Bag boasts a 10-degree Fahrenheit temperature rating. It’s designed to keep you comfortable in frigid conditions. The bag measures 40″ x 84″, accommodating individuals up to 6’7″ in height.
The bag features a cotton cover and cotton flannel lining. This provides a soft and comfortable sleeping surface. It also incorporates a Thermolock system to minimize heat loss through the zipper.
Its construction includes Fiberlock to prevent insulation shifting. There is also a patented zipper system that resists snags. The patented Roll Control system and no-tie packing system simplify storage.
These specifications are crucial for overall performance. The temperature rating determines the bag’s suitability for specific climates and seasons. The size ensures comfortable accommodation for taller individuals. The materials contribute to warmth and comfort. Finally, the design features enhance ease of use and long-term durability.

Pros and Cons of Coleman Heritage 10in. Big Tall Sleeping Bag
Pros
- Exceptionally warm, providing reliable protection down to 10 degrees Fahrenheit.
- Comfortable cotton cover and flannel lining offer a soft and cozy sleeping surface.
- Spacious design comfortably accommodates taller individuals up to 6’7″.
- Snag-free zipper with Thermolock system prevents heat loss and ensures easy entry/exit.
- Machine washable for easy cleaning and maintenance.
Cons
- The bag is bulky, potentially posing a challenge for backpacking or storage.
- Cotton cover may not be as water-resistant as synthetic alternatives.
